US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"were assessed alongside"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ing evaluations or comparisons that occur simultaneously with other subjects or items. Example: "The students' performances were assessed alongside their participation in extracurricular activities."

Is it correct to say "were assessed alongside" or "was assessed alongside"?

"Were assessed alongside" is used when referring to multiple subjects, while "was assessed alongside" is used for a single subject. For example: "The students' performances "were assessed alongside" their participation" versus "The student's performance "was assessed alongside" their participation".

What is the difference between "were assessed alongside" and "were assessed independently"?

"Were assessed alongside" indicates a simultaneous and possibly comparative evaluation, whereas "were assessed independently" suggests separate, unrelated assessments.
